Position: Principal Data Scientist NextRoll Corporate San Francisco, New York City, or Remote

You’ll join our Data & Analytics team reporting to our Sr. Director, Data & Analytics and leading the end-to-end development and deployment of MxL models—focusing on churn, retention, and LTV—and driving product insights using causal inference and experimentation for areas like targeting and bidding. As a Principal Data Scientist, you will be an individual contributor where your impact will be quantifying the business value of key initiatives, influencing product roadmaps with data-driven opportunity sizing, and operationalizing data products for personalized customer journeys.

Success will require close collaboration with Engineering and Machine Learning Platform teams for scalable data pipelines and model deployment.

This role is open in San Francisco, New York City, or Remote locations.

The impact you’ll make:
  • Lead the design, development, and deployment of ML models that predict and influence customer behavior — including churn, retention, activation, lifetime value, and lifecycle transitions.
  • Build behavioral segmentation frameworks, uplift models, and propensity scoring used across product, lifecycle marketing, and account strategy.
  • Drive insights for core product areas (audience targeting, measurement, bidding, onboarding, campaign performance) using a mix of causal inference, predictive modeling, and experimentation.
  • Own end-to-end analytics for key initiatives: partner with Product to define success metrics, guide instrumentation, design experiments, and quantify impact.
  • Design, build and deploy rigorous and statistically sound models and systems that help customers understand causal effects of their marketing strategies.
  • Influence product roadmaps using quantified opportunity sizing, behavioral funnel analysis, and deep dives into customer usage patterns.
  • Collaborate with Data Engineering and ML Platform teams to build scalable pipelines, datasets, and model operationalization workflows.
  • Act as a technical mentor for the broader analytics and data science team; elevate scientific rigor, model quality, and best practices.
Skills you’ll bring:
  • 9+ years of experience in data science, machine learning, or advanced analytics roles, ideally in a SaaS, AdTech, or Mar Tech environment.
  • Knowledge of and experience in implementing marketing data science models such as predictive models (churn, retention, LTV), advanced segmentation and behavioral clustering.
  • Skilled in causal inference techniques (e.g., synthetic controls, DiD, uplift modeling, geo-experiments, CUPED) and experimentation frameworks.
  • Knowledge of ad ecosystems (RTB, attribution, identity graphs, bidding strategies, pixel events, campaign optimization, incrementality).
  • Strong fluency in SQL and Python, with hands-on experience building and shipping production-grade ML models.
  • Proven track record partnering with Product to define metrics, run experiments, and shape product strategy.
  • Excellent data storytelling abilities — able to translate complex patterns into clear, action-oriented recommendations for cross-functional partners.
  • Comfortable navigating ambiguous problem spaces and driving long-term analytical strategy.
